如何使用node.js和更多实现步骤从javascript调用jar API

如何使用node.js和更多实现步骤从javascript调用jar API,javascript,java,jar,Javascript,Java,Jar,我试图在不同的技术堆栈中重用代码。 比如说: 我有一个罐子,它包含以下类别定义: package com.gallop; import java.io.File; import java.io.IOException; public class GenerateFile { public void generateFile(String fileName) { File file = new File(fileName); try {

我试图在不同的技术堆栈中重用代码。 比如说: 我有一个罐子,它包含以下类别定义:

package com.gallop;

import java.io.File;
import java.io.IOException;

public class GenerateFile {

    public void generateFile(String fileName)
    {
        File file = new File(fileName);
        try {
            file.createNewFile();
        } catch (IOException e) {
            // TODO Auto-generated catch block
            e.printStackTrace();
        }
    }
}
现在,代码被导出到filegenerator.jar


现在,问题是如何使用filegenerator.jar中的类使用javascript创建文件。基本上,我已经为jar导入了GenerateFile类。我必须创建GenerateFile的实例。然后使用GenerateFile的实例,我应该能够调用方法GenerateFile,并将filePath作为参数。

创建文件的可能副本确切位置在哪里?javascript从哪里来?在浏览器中?Node.js?